how is a prokaryotic cell different from a Eukaryotic cell

Difference between prokaryotic cell and Eukaryotic cell :-
Prokaryotic cell :-
  1.  the size of prokaryotic sale remains small.
  2.  the nuclear area contains chromatin only and it is usually called cyton.
  3. It has single chromosome.
  4. It does not contain membrane-bound cell organlless.
Eukaryotic cell :-
  1. The size of Eukaryotic cell usually remail big. 
  2. The nuclear area is wale clear and it is surrounded by nuclear membrane.
  3. It has more chromosome in pairs.
  4. It contains membrane-bound cell  organlless.
